Output 9a58c7c74e3f5b36012761270a909765914ad4fccc47d76730fd19964da45d27:18
- value
- 626800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21015ed2abb0c2fabcd015e751b4c21f8bef4077 OP_EQUAL
- address
- 34hXs6Fbka99XbxKYGvDj2z6ogkPEA2uyN
- transaction
- 9a58c7c74e3f5b36012761270a909765914ad4fccc47d76730fd19964da45d27